I wouldn't be so sure about this. Having come from using a tablet exclusively, I was dreading using a tiny iPhone 6. But I'm amazed about how usable it is. Don't forget, most highish end phones have got screens that are optmised for outdoor use, whereas most tablet screens are designed to be used indoors. There is a massive difference with glare....At least that's what I'm finding.

What's the oldest iPad that will work? ipad mini 2 says device not supported when I try to download the app. This is a fairly recent change..
The latest version of the DJI GO app in the app store is 3.1.0, released on Nov 14. In the compatibility section it distinctly says "Requires iOS 8.0 or later. Compatible with ... iPad mini 2, iPad mini 2 Wi-Fi + Cellular...."
Have you tried downloading again? and were you on Wi-Fi when you tried, as the app is 178MB?
